We are looking for an Operations Assistant to support our Mental Health Crisis Stabilization Facility (Ekolu) located in Kaneohe!

Ekolu is a program of Community Empowerment Resources (CER), a nonprofit 501(c)(3). CER’s mission is to provide progressive and inclusive health care, empowering individuals to lead fuller lives. We are a case management agency, staffed with caring employees, working to help the mentally ill population of Oahu integrate more fully into the community.

You will be supporting our mission by providing a warm and welcoming environment for clients at Ekolu, as well as providing operational support to help serve our clients and our facility. Administrative employees are vital members of our team, ensuring compliance and maintenance of our facility and services.

Our Ekolu team focuses on care coordination, quality assurance and continual improvement. The team is close knit that collaborates in innovative problem solving and professional development. You will have the opportunity to learn our health care system and work with a team of thoughtful professionals.

This position reports directly to the Team Leader of Ekolu, with additional oversight from the Chier Operating Officer. This in an onsite, in-person position, reporting Monday-Friday, 8:00 am – 4:00 pm. The Ekolu facility is a 24 x 7 x 365 operation, and there maybe overtime work paid at time and a half.
